Is my 4-month-old puppy's 26 lb weight normal or underweight?

Updated on September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Dog | Labrador Retriever | Male | unneutered | 4 months and 9 days old | 26 lbs

My dog is 4-5 month old and is 12kgs. Is this appropriate for a dog to be 12kgs at this age or isn't? If he is under Weight how should we help him increase his weight?

At 12kg (26.4 pounds) Iggy sounds like a normal weight. Please don't try to overfeed him to make him bigger. That will cause growth abnormalities. He is not too thin unless you see all his ribs showing. Most dogs are too fat in general so it is best to keep him lean. Here is a link that may help you more:
